Understanding the ANCC FNP Exam
The ANCC FNP certification exam is designed to assess the knowledge and skills necessary for nurse practitioners to provide quality care to patients across the lifespan. The exam covers a wide array of topics, including:
- Assessment and Diagnosis: Evaluating patient health status, interpreting diagnostic tests, and formulating differential diagnoses.
- Clinical Management: Developing treatment plans, implementing interventions, and monitoring patient outcomes.
- Health Promotion and Disease Prevention: Educating patients on wellness practices and preventive care.
- Professional Practice: Understanding legal and ethical considerations, healthcare policies, and collaborative practice.
Exam Format
The ANCC FNP exam consists of:
- Length: 175 multiple-choice questions
- Time Limit: 3.5 hours
- Scoring: A passing scaled score is set, typically between 350 and 500.
It is crucial to familiarize yourself with the exam format and the types of questions that will be asked to optimize your performance.

Test-Taking Tips
As the exam date approaches, it's essential to refine your test-taking strategies:
Understand the Question Format
- Read each question carefully and pay attention to qualifiers like "always," "never," or "most likely."
- Eliminate clearly incorrect answers to improve your chances of selecting the correct one.
Manage Your Time Effectively
- Keep an eye on the clock and pace yourself throughout the exam.
- If you encounter a difficult question, mark it and move on, returning to it later if time permits.
Stay Calm and Confident
- Practice relaxation techniques before and during the exam to reduce anxiety.
- Trust your preparation and instincts, and remember that you have the knowledge to succeed.
